Frisch’s Big Boy Restaurants

Frisch’s had been trying to solve a very familiar problem for quite some time. They had an American pop icon as the symbol of their brand. They had a very passionate, yet aging, audience. They had an origin story that included the support of an entire large metropolitan city. They knew they had to work on the food, and they were doing so, but in the meantime they had to stay relevant and retain their core. The younger demo that they needed to reach appreciated nostalgia and actually embraced historic brands. Job one was to find a new customer to fill the leaky bucket that was their core. That started with a reinvention of Big Boy himself.
